setlist
MFFF (plugged, on electric guitar)
9 crimes
Delicate
Cannonball
It takes a lot to know a man
Trusty & True (harmonium)
Camarillas
The Professor
Colour Me In
Elephant
I Remember

I don´t want to change you (on electric guitar)
The greatest bastard
The blower´s daughter
Volcano
Long Long Way

no Cold Water bit tonight. Loved the opening MFFF on electric guitar... IDWTCY was also on electric guitar, nice talk before that, think he said it´s the love song he´s written, like a true love song...

Mia Maestro opened with Joel on guitar, not crazy about the songs... she did not duet with Damien (as I expected)

Damo was chatty, well, not much at the start but became more chatty as the gig progressed... he told some stories in French, before T&T... also a long rant about being in love and making lists of what the loved one can/cannot do... he said he eventually ended up being in love with one person (he didn´t say names but it´s obvious who he´s talking about) and he wrote IDWTCY, which is his only love song...

never seen an audience singing so much, from the very start, Delicate, even the newies,... after Volcano Damien said something like, I didn´t wanna do this (the singing part with the audience divided in 3 groups), but if you wanna sing, let´s ****ing sing
